How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Ocala?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Ocala Studio Apartments | $876 | $525 | $1,229 |
| Ocala 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,412 | $550 | $2,558 |
| Ocala 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,597 | $625 | $2,717 |
| Ocala 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,895 | $800 | $3,766 |
| Ocala 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,615 | $850 | $2,350 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 2 Bedroom Ocala Apartments
How much is the average rent for a 2 Bedroom Ocala Apartment?
The average rent for a 2 Bedroom Apartment in Ocala is $1,597.
What is the largest available 2 Bedroom Ocala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Ocala is a 1,445 square feet unit starting from $1,780 at West Shire Village.
What is the average size for Ocala 2 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 2 Bedroom rental in Ocala is currently 1,194 sq ft.
